TECHNICAL FIELD

[0001] The utility model belongs to the technical field of detection device, especially relate to a buffer solution bottle. BACKGROUND

[0002] In the new technology for measuring the concentration of new indicators by the electrochemical workstation at present, especially for the measurement of the electrochemical workstation by using non-enzyme catalyst and other methods in biological detection, the measured solvent in the electrolytic cell needs to be diluted in a certain proportion, and the pH value of the measured solvent needs to be controlled.

[0003] In the electrochemical laboratory, the detection is carried out by using a pipette, a measuring tool, standard chemical reagents and a pH meter and other instruments, and the measured solvent is diluted in a certain proportion, and the specific steps are as follows:

[0004] 1. The required volume of the measured sample is accurately taken out by using a pipette, a pipette or a micro pipette;

[0005] 2. The measured sample is added to a clean and dry test tube or beaker;

[0006] 3. Then, the corresponding volume of the dilution solvent is added, and the mixture is fully mixed to ensure uniform distribution.

[0007] The above dilution steps are too complex, not convenient and quick, and not conducive to home detection. INVENTION CONTENT

[0008] In order to solve the problem that the dilution steps in the existing detection process are too complex, not convenient and quick, and not conducive to home detection, the utility model provides a buffer solution bottle which is simple to operate and convenient for home detection.

[0009] The technical scheme of the utility model lies in:

[0010] The utility model discloses a buffer solution bottle, including bottle body and bottle lid, the bottle lid can be detached and installed on the bottle body, the bottle body is equipped with buffer solution, the bottle body or the bottle lid is equipped with the clamping structure.

[0011] The first scheme: the clamping structure is to be worn film, the bottle lid is equipped with the opening, the film to be worn is equipped in the opening.

[0012] The second scheme: the clamping structure is the rubber block with first clamping mouth, and the bottle lid is not equipped with the opening, the inner wall of the bottle body is equipped with the installation groove, and the rubber block is clamped in the installation groove.

[0013] The third scheme: the clamping structure is the clamping block with second clamping mouth, and the bottle lid is not equipped with the opening, the inner wall of the bottle body is equipped with internal thread, the outer wall of the clamping block is equipped with external thread, and the internal thread is screwed with the external thread.

[0014] Further, a sealing ring is arranged between the bottle body and the bottle cap.

[0029] Example 1

[0030] Please refer to Figures 1-3 The utility model provides a buffer solution bottle, including bottle body 1 and bottle cap 2, bottle cap 2 can be detached and installed on bottle body 1, be equipped with buffer solution 11 in bottle body 1, be equipped with clamping structure 3 on bottle body 1 or bottle cap 2.

[0031] Specifically, the clamping structure 3 is a to-be-pierced film 31, the bottle cap 2 is provided with an opening 21, and the to-be-pierced film 31 is arranged in the opening 21.

[0032] Further, a sealing ring 4 is arranged between the bottle body 1 and the bottle cap 2. By arranging the sealing ring 4, the liquid in the bottle body 1 can be prevented from leaking.

[0033] When the buffer solution bottle is used in an electrochemical workstation to detect urine protein components in urine, the specific use steps of the buffer solution bottle and the article carrying the to-be-tested solvent are as follows:

[0034] S1: the volume of the to-be-tested solvent on the article carrying the to-be-tested solvent is L1;

[0035] S2: taking out the buffer solution bottle, aligning the to-be-tested solvent on the article carrying the to-be-tested solvent with the to-be-pierced membrane 31 on the buffer solution bottle, inserting with force, piercing the to-be-pierced membrane 31, and inserting the article carrying the to-be-tested solvent into the bottle body 1 of the buffer solution bottle;

[0036] S3: gently shaking the buffer solution bottle to make the to-be-tested solvent on the article carrying the to-be-tested solvent fully mix with the liquid in the buffer solution bottle, and assuming that the volume of the buffer solution in the buffer bottle is L2, then the to-be-tested solvent is diluted to L1 / (L1+L2).

[0037] In summary, the buffer solution can be set to a fixed volume as required, and since the volume of the solvent on the article carrying the to-be-tested solvent is also fixed, accurate proportion dilution can be performed to ensure the pH value of the to-be-tested solvent; and the operation steps do not require special tools to be taken out or the volume of the buffer solution to be weighed, and can be directly used, thereby being very convenient for home testing and use, and being convenient, fast and easy to operate.

[0038] Embodiment 2

[0039] Please refer to Figure 4 The utility model provides a buffer solution bottle, including bottle body 1 and bottle cover 2, bottle cover 2 detachable installation on bottle body 1, be equipped with buffer solution in bottle body 1, be equipped with clamping structure 3 on bottle body 1 or bottle cover 2.

[0040] Clamping structure 3 is the rubber block 32 with first clamping port 321, and bottle cover 2 is without opening 21, the inner wall of bottle body 1 is equipped with installation groove 12, and rubber block 32 is clamped in installation groove 12. Because the surface friction of rubber block 32 is larger, first clamping port 321 can be well clamped with the article carrying the to-be-tested solvent.

[0041] Further, a sealing ring 4 is arranged between the bottle body 1 and the bottle cap 2.

[0042] Embodiment 3

[0043] Please refer to Figure 5 The utility model provides a buffer solution bottle, including bottle body 1 and bottle cover 2, bottle cover 2 detachable installation on bottle body 1, be equipped with buffer solution in bottle body 1, be equipped with clamping structure 3 on bottle body 1 or bottle cover 2.

[0044] The clamping structure 3 is a clamping block 33 provided with a second clamping opening 331, and the bottle cap 2 is not provided with an opening 21, the inner wall of the bottle body 1 is provided with an internal thread 13, the outer wall of the clamping block 33 is provided with an external thread 332, and the internal thread 13 is in threaded cooperation with the external thread 332. The size of the second clamping opening 331 matches the size of the article carrying the to-be-tested solvent, so that the article carrying the to-be-tested solvent can be clamped on the second clamping opening 331.

[0045] Further, the bottle body 1 and the bottle cap 2 are provided with a sealing ring 4.
